What does the Bible say about grace in a generation under judgment?

Answered in 1 source

The Bible assures that grace is available to those seeking mercy amid a judgment-laden generation (Romans 1:7).

In times when God's judgment is evident, Romans 1:7 reminds us that grace is still accessible to those who call on the Lord. The reality of a generation deserving judgment does not negate God’s willingness to extend mercy to His chosen people. It is through His grace that individuals can find hope and salvation, despite the pervasive wickedness around them. This grace operates not just as an individual benefit but as a communal strength, encouraging believers to live faithfully and proclaim the gospel of grace in a world that often rejects it.
